How to Get a Locksmith for Cars

It is vital to replace your keys when you lose or lock your keys. Besides replacing the keys, you must also take care of your ignition switch and door lock. There are some things you can handle yourself, however, you must call a locksmith for more sophisticated work.

Replace the ignition switch

If you own a car with an ignition switch that is damaged, you can have it replaced by a professional locksmith. This is a service commonly demanded by car keys locksmith owners. Ignition switches made out of metal wear out over time. When they get jammed or damaged, they can malfunction.

A professional locksmith will have all the equipment needed to fix the switch and provide a reliable quick service. They can also assist you with other auto-related repairs, such as fixing a transponder that is stuck.

If you're looking to replace an ignition switch yourself it is necessary to first disconnect the battery. This is the most crucial step in any auto repair. You'll then need to remove the plastic cover around the ignition switch. Then take the wires off.

Based on the model of your vehicle, you may have to replace the entire ignition system or just the switch. Some vehicles have an immobilizer, which is essentially an anti-theft device. These require special keys.

A key that isn't working is another common problem with ignition switches. You might be able make use of a spare key however, if you have an immobilizer system it is necessary to replace your car's ignition key.

Once the old switch was replaced, you'll have to install the new one. This can be a complex task, especially if you're installing a more complicated cylinder.

If your ignition switch is equipped with a wiring diagram you'll be able to verify that all wiring is connected correctly. Incorrectly connected wiring could prevent the new ignition from functioning.

Based on the car's model the process for replacing it can take up to an hour. However, some companies provide an upfront cost, so you'll know exactly how much it will cost prior to committing.

Find a replacement key

Locksmiths can repair car keys. Locksmiths are equipped with the latest technology and tools to program and create new keys. If you're able to find the best price and you're able to get an additional key for your car at an even lower price.

The first step is to find the vehicle's identification number (VIN). You can locate this number on the dashboard of the driver's side or under the rear wheel well, or on the metal plate located on the door jamb of the driver.

It can be expensive and frustrating to find an alternative key for your car. Depending on the type of car you have, you could pay up to $250. In some cases you can purchase keys for less than $10.

For more complex keys, you'll need to pay more to have the key programmed. This can be accomplished at an area locksmith or dealer. It might take several days to obtain the key.

You can purchase keys online in the event that you're unable locate the key you need in your vehicle. Many websites offer keys that are factory-replaced for less than you'll pay at the dealership. You may be required to bring your vehicle to the dealer based on the model and the make of your vehicle in order to have the key programmed.

The dealership will require evidence of ownership and registration. The process of getting a new key from an auto dealer is simple. They can also connect the new key with your vehicle.

Modern cars usually have transponders. Transponder keys are typically laser-cut and come with an embedded chip. To program a transponder, you will need to be capable of reading the codes that are on the key.

Remove broken, bent, or stuck keys

If you have a stuck key, there are a few options to try. First, you may need to turn off the engine and apply your emergency brake. You can also try to lubricate your locking mechanism. However, if that isn't working, you might require locksmith.

You can also try removing the broken portion of the key. This can be accomplished with a pair of tweezers or pliers. However, you should not be too close to the lock. If you do, you'll damage the lock and force it further into the lock.

Key extractors are tool that can be used to get rid of the broken pieces when you are unsure. This tool is equipped with an attachment on one side and an opening on the other. To begin, you will need the tool to be placed into the locked cylinder. Make sure that the tool is pointed towards the upwards.

Another method to remove the broken bit of the key is to apply a sticky putty to the tip. It is necessary to allow the putty to rest for a few minutes. You can then jiggle the key to loosen it.

For even more advanced methods you can seek out an auto locksmith keys in car. The auto locksmith will have the experience and tools to retrieve the damaged key.

You can also place a paperclip into the keyhole. If the key is bent or jammed, you can bend the paperclip to hold the piece of the key. Make sure that the clip isn't too slender.
